Understanding Slingo: A Hybrid Model of Engagement
Slingo combines familiar mechanics from classic casino games with innovative gameplay layers. Unlike traditional slots, Slingo integrates real-time bingo elements, such as number marking and pattern completion, adding a strategic component that heightens user interaction. This hybrid approach not only broadens appeal but also allows operators to tailor experiences with themed graphics, custom rules, and leaderboard integration.
Technological Foundations and Industry Adoption
The success of Slingo relies heavily on advanced digital platforms capable of delivering seamless, high-quality experiences across devices. Thanks to HTML5 technology and cloud-based gaming servers, Slingo titles can be accessed intuitively on desktops, tablets, and smartphones, aligning with industry shifts towards mobile-first gaming. Regulatory and Responsible Gaming Considerations
Ensuring compliance with gambling regulations is essential as Slingo titles gain prominence. Regulators are increasingly scrutinizing game fairness, transparency, and player protection. Developers of Slingo games incorporate features such as spending limits, time-outs, and random number audits to uphold integrity and promote responsible gaming practices.
